MYLO (Open School for Languages)

MYLOMYLO is a new free online learning tool designed to get young people engaging with languages in an innovative, creative and imaginative way.

Initially aimed at Key Stage 3, it engages learners both independently and in the classroom through a range of activities that have been designed to make languages more ‘real’. The languages covered by the service are French, German, Spanish and Mandarin.

The vision for MYLO is to help more young people discover the relevance and value of languages by switching them on to language learning and holding their interest. The service equips teachers with varied, flexible, compelling new techniques to engage learners in and out of the classroom.

MYLO contains innovative online challenges for teenagers including producing a TV advert, working in a French fashion house and designing a football kit. With practice materials, online dictionaries, phrase books, background information and plenty of hints and tips, learners have everything they need to complete tasks online.

Lightbox Education has been working with leading language learning specialists to develop content and promote the service. CILT is a key partner, along with Cambridge University, ALL and the University of Salford.
